Southern Illinoisan (Carbondale,Illinois) • Thu, Dec 7, 1989 • Page 15:
MURPHYSBORO — Florence M. "Flo" Gould, 46, of Route 4 died at 2 a.m. Saturday, Dec. 2, 1989, in St. Joseph Memorial Hospital.
Services were Monday in Pettett Funeral Home, with burial in Murdale Gardens of Memory.
Mrs.Gould worked as a convenience store clerk.
She was a member of Women of the Moose Lodge 1024.
She was born June 25,1943, in Jackson County to William and Valena (Jarvis) Anderson.
She was engaged to Lee Schroeder of Murphysboro. He survives.
Other survivors include three daughters, Vickie Simpkins, Deana Simpkins of Jackson County and Judy Martin of De Soto; her mother of Murphysboro; and three brothers, Carl Jarvis of Carterville, and Floyd and Don Anderson, both of Murphysboro.
Her father, two brothers and one sister preceded her in death.

She was killed in a semi-truck accident in Murphysboro with 3 others.
